Understanding Different Types of Seals
Before diving into repair methods, it is important to comprehend the different types of seals and their applications. Here are some examples:
Seal TypeDescriptionApplicationsO-RingsCircular rings that create a seal in a groove when compressed.Hydraulic systems, automobile enginesGasketsFlat seals created to fill the space in between 2 mating surfaces.Flange connections, pipes systemsLip SealsSeals with a versatile lip that maintains contact with a turning shaft.Motors, gearboxesMechanical SealsDevices that create a seal at the interface of turning equipment.Pumps, compressorsTypical Causes of Seal Failure
Understanding the factors behind seal failure can assist avoid expensive downtime. Some common causes consist of:
Wear and Tear: Continuous operation leads to natural wear on seals, compromising their stability.Inappropriate Installation: Incorrect setup can result in instant failure.Chemical Exposure: Seals can deteriorate if exposed to severe chemicals or severe temperatures.Misalignment: Misaligned equipment can trigger excessive tension on seals, leading to failure.Insufficient Lubrication: Insufficient lubrication can increase friction and result in getting too hot.Indications That a Seal Needs Repair
Spotting seal failure early can save time and resources. Here are indications to view for:
Leaks: Visible fluid leaks around seals show failure.Sound: Unusual sounds from equipment can suggest used seals.Vibration: Excessive vibration might indicate misalignment or worn seals.Overheating: Equipment running hotter than normal may suggest seal failure.Seal Repair Techniques
Repairing a seal can frequently be more cost-efficient than changing entire parts. Here are some typical techniques:
1. Changing O-Rings or Gaskets
O-Ring or gasket replacement is relatively simple. Here's a detailed guide:
Step 1: Disassemble the parts to access the seal.Step 2: Remove the old seal, making sure no residues are left.Step 3: Clean the sealing surface areas completely.Step 4: Apply a suitable lube to the new seal and install it thoroughly.2. Retrofitting with Repair Sleeves
For used shafts, a repair sleeve can bring back performance without costly replacements:
Step 1: Clean the shaft surface thoroughly.Action 2: Measure the shaft to choose the appropriate sleeve size.Action 3: Slide the sleeve over the broken area.Step 4: Reinstall the seal onto the sleeve.3. Using Sealant Compounds
In many cases, a sealant may be proper to reinforce a used seal:
Step 1: Clean the area around the seal.Action 2: Apply a sealant substance as per instructions.Step 3: Allow it to cure completely before operating the equipment.4. Mechanical Seal Repair
For mechanical Window Frame Seals, rebuilding or changing elements may be essential:
Step 1: Remove the mechanical seal assembly.Step 2: Replace worn parts (e.g., springs, deals with).Step 3: Thoroughly clean the real estate before re-installing the new assembly.Preventive Maintenance Tips

A: The life expectancy of a Seal Replacement can differ commonly based upon application, ecological conditions, and maintenance. Routine examinations every three to 6 months are recommended.
Q: Can I repair a seal myself?
A: Yes, numerous seal repairs, especially O-Ring and gasket replacements, can be done by somebody with basic mechanical skills. Nevertheless, complicated repair work may need professional assistance.
Q: What should I do if I find a leak?
A: Investigate the source of the leak. If it's a seal, examine whether it can be fixed or requires replacement. If unsure, consult an expert.
Q: Can seal products be personalized?
A: Yes, seals can be made from numerous materials (e.g., rubber, silicone, PTFE) to suit particular applications and environments.
Q: Is seal repair constantly affordable?
A: Not always. The decision ought to think about the severity of the damage, the cost of repair work versus replacement, and the importance of the equipment's reliability.
